
Are You Wasting This Important Thing?
About this episode
Imagine meeting a version of yourself who seized every opportunity, lived without regrets, and maximized every ounce of potential. This is the intriguing notion I discuss in today's episode. Inspired by an eye-opening subway conversation with a friend in New York, I share a profound definition of hell: encountering the person you could have been. It's a poignant reminder of the internal motivation we all possess, urging us to break free from comfort zones and societal expectations. We explore the metaphor of life as a hero's journey and challenge ourselves to ensure our story is one worth telling.
